Planning for your future doesn't just involve estates and tangible possessions anymore; it’s also about safeguarding your digital footprint . Digital legacy planning involves determining what happens to your online identities – online – after you’re gone to manage them. This includes appointing a trusted person to handle your online information , closing accounts, and ensuring important files are secured. It's a growing consideration for everyone, regardless of age or status to ensure your digital self is treated with the respect it deserves.

Protecting Your Online Accounts: A Digital Legacy Checklist
Securing your online presences is absolutely here vital for preserving your sensitive information and creating a lasting digital legacy. This compilation helps confirm you are ready to handle potential challenges relating to profile management and long-term preservation. Regularly checking logins, enabling dual-factor security and appointing trusted contacts are key steps in creating a secure digital structure for those who follow to benefit from.
